## Authentication

The Squallcast fan-out worker pushes weather alerts to every subscribed channel, and each push has to authenticate against our internal RelayNest gateway first. No key, no fan-out — you'll just see silent drops in the queue, which is fun to debug. Grab the dev-tier key, stick it in your env, and you're set. For local testing, use the key below.

gateway credential: kto3_qfe

Ticket: PARTSVC-482 — Heads up for the weekly sync: the monthly partition roller on Quillbase stopped creating new partitions because the service credential expired last Friday. November's table never got made, so writes are piling into the default partition and queries are crawling. Tomas rotated the cred this morning and backfilled the missing partitions, so we're good through Q2. Action item: add expiry alerts so this doesn't bite us again. For anyone re-running the roller manually, use the refreshed key below.

app token of yajeg-kawef = kto11_7En3XSX8xQw

## Onboarding — Markdown Pipeline (Inkmere)

Inkmere docs render through a three-stage pipeline: parse, sanitize, emit. Releases rebuild all templates; never hot-patch emitted HTML. Broken renders usually mean a sanitizer rule change — check the rules diff first. The render cluster only accepts builds from the release channel, and every build artifact must be signed before upload. Sign artifacts with the deploy key below.

release key, hafop-tajef: bky13_s2vaFVNJTHfBL

**Mgmt Meeting Minutes — Retiring the Brightline Range**

Quick recap for sales leads at Fenholt Supplies: we agreed to retire the Brightline fixture range by year-end. Remaining stock moves to clearance pricing next month, and accounts on standing orders get migrated to the Lumetta range. Trade-in incentives were approved in principle. The confidential note on next steps sits just below.

board note of bajof-bajeg: The pricing group signed off on a budget of $13.4 million for Project Sildor. The renewal with Lamixek Holdings closes at $48.9 million a year, 49 percent above the last contract.